The introduction of the 2012-2013 Peacekeeper takes K2’s backcountry heritage and experience and applies it in the most critical and aggressive lines there are to be found. Loading BC rocker into a squashed tail directional gun shape, The K2 Peacekeeper is built for speed, edgehold on steeps and cliff drop landing power.
A revolutionary tweek to the ends of our industry leading Baseline technology. By extending the Baseline rocker all the way out to the absolute ends of the board, new ride-able surface is unlocked, giving you a bigger, more stable platform to press, float and land on.
The Ollie bar is a totally new approach to adding pop to a snowboard. Built in place in a pre-loaded, cambered shape it solves the concern that rocker board don’t have the pop camber board have.Made with a secret layup of carbon, Kevlar and urethane layers, the ollie bar is positioned in the center of the board between the binding inserts. Strong ollies and pressing power doesn’t come from the tail alone. The backbone center section is actually more critical for smooth even pressure. You gotta try it to believe the pop.
